DescriptionCVE.org

Subscriber Broken Access Control in Gravity Booster &#8211; Styles &amp; Layouts for Gravity Forms <= 6.0 versions.

AnalysisAI

Broken access control in Gravity Booster - Styles & Layouts for Gravity Forms (WordPress plugin by WPMonks) through version 6.0 permits any authenticated subscriber to invoke functionality restricted to higher-privileged roles, yielding limited but real confidentiality and integrity impact. Reported by Patchstack and catalogued as EUVD-2026-60813, the flaw stems from missing authorization checks (CWE-862) on plugin operations, enabling subscriber-level users to read or modify form style and layout configurations beyond their intended permissions. …

Exploitation Exploitation requires Gravity Booster - Styles & Layouts for Gravity Forms version 6.0 or earlier to be installed and activated on the target WordPress site, and the attacker must hold a valid subscriber-level (or higher) WordPress account on that site, as confirmed by CVSS PR:L. … Additional conditions and limiting factors are described in the full assessment.
Risk Assessment The CVSS 5.4 Medium score (AV:N/AC:L/PR:L/UI:N/S:U/C:L/I:L/A:N) accurately reflects a network-reachable, low-complexity flaw that nonetheless requires a valid authenticated session, capping realistic attacker pool to those who can obtain a subscriber account. … Full risk analysis with EPSS, KEV, and SSVC signal comparison available after sign-in.
Exploit Scenario An attacker registers a free subscriber account on a WordPress site with open registration and Gravity Booster <= 6.0 active, then crafts authenticated HTTP requests (AJAX or REST) targeting the plugin's unprotected action handlers to read or overwrite form styling and layout configurations. Because the attack requires only a low-privilege session and no user interaction, it is straightforward for any registered user to attempt. …
